The mechanical pressing method to remove oil was common until the early 1900s. After this, the solvent extraction plants began to prevail, especially in Europe, because of their greater effectiveness in soy oil removal. As a result, more than 90% of the world's soy oil was solvent extracted by 1970. Global Soybean Oil Consumption

The standard soybean oil pressing Production process includes multiple steps such as cleaning, crushing, softening, embryo rolling, steaming, pressing and filtering. Different types of oilseeds have different pressing Production processes. The residual oil rate in the oilseed meal after pressing is generally about 6%.
- How is soybean oil extracted in a continuous and countercurrent process?
- Extraction of soybean oil in a continuous and countercurrent process. Multistage extraction was experimentally reproduced from batch single-stage assays. The process efficiency was mainly limited by the oil solubility in the solvent. The minimum solvent mass flow and the number of ideal stages were calculated.

- Can ethanol be used as a co-solvent for soybean oil extraction?
- The extraction of soybean oil using ethanol mixed with biodiesel as a co-solvent was analyzed by Dagostin et al. . It was noticed that high temperatures positively affect the extraction. To use hydrated ethanol as a solvent, it was necessary to use vast amounts of biodiesel as co-solvent to reach the exact extraction yield as anhydrous.
- How is oil extracted from soybeans?
- Due to the moderate oil content (18 ¨C 23%mass) , it is mandatorily recovered from soybeans by solvent extraction . Currently, industries adopt a continuous-countercurrent-multistage extractor for oil extraction from vegetable oilseeds.
- Which terpene is best for soybean oil extraction?
- Oil extraction yield is more significant when using terpenes, CPME, and 2-MeTHF. In contrast, some advanced technologies such as enzyme-assisted, supercritical fluids, deep eutectic solvent, and ionic liquids seem less efficient than ordinary processes using hexane for soybean oil extraction.
- Which solvent is used in soybean oil production?
- Solvent extraction and expelling are the main processes used in soybean oil production. Hexane is currently the leading solvent in extraction , . This solvent has a high solubility for oil extraction, availability, low price, low boiling point, and heat of vaporization .
